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3277333 2885 22376778323
545151 17006406 968699
545151 17006406 968699
9768119 65567681 73016
All about undefined
Interested in learning more?
545151 17006406 968699
9768119 65567681 73016
See more
19133244450 6821628124 3386966163
597053007 23871 769931397
See more
7292194 9030039101
927 7400648 85638248
See more